The tech community is going wild over a new revelation from the shadowy field of chipset development. The appearance of the codename SM8635 suggests that Qualcomm may be working on a new and affordable Snapdragon 8s Gen series chip. Let’s dive into the details.

Updated on February 21, 2024: Another tipster on X has confirmed that the SM8635 chip we have been seeing around is indeed the Snapdragapon 8s Gen 3 and the SM7675 chip is the Snapdragon 7+ Gen 3.

Read the original story below:

Reputable tipster Digital Chat Station just revealed the new codename SM8635 on Weibo. Even though the actual name is still a mystery, rumors indicate that this processor will be part of the highly regarded Snapdragon 8 Gen series.

Not only did the leak provide the codename, but it also gave us a look at some of the specs of SM8635. This chipset boasts an impressive 2.9GHz ARM Cortex X4 core, which indicates a similar architecture to that of the Snapdragon 8 Gen 3.

Adding to its processing power is the Adreno 735 GPU, which suggests better graphics capabilities and an overall better user experience. Rumors indicate that the SM8635 could potentially surpass the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 in terms of sheer performance. 

Nevertheless, the chipset’s specs indicate that it will be placed somewhere between the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 and the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 in terms of raw performance. This could mean that the chipset will be named Snapdragon 8+ Gen 2 or Snapdragon 8s Gen 3.

A tipser on X, Roland Quandt, reveals Qualcomm’s plan to release two models with identical specs. He states to have found no difference between the SM8635 and the SM7675. SM7675 seems to be the codename for a Snapdragon 7 Gen series chip but nothing is concrete as of now.

The future is uncertain, but you can look forward to hearing speculations about possible flagship competitors. Rumor has it that the highly anticipated SM8635 could be carried by the Redmi Note 13 Turbo and POCO F6, putting them in the limelight. These devices should make a debut in Q2 2024.

The SM8635 could be an affordable alternative to the Snapdragon 8 Gen 3, making its way to the upper-midrange smartphones. With the official name and the detailed specifications still unknown, the SM8635 leak has sparked intrigue and excitement, and we can’t wait for the official announcement.
